Central Florida Real Estate Recap of October 2025

Orlando Regional REALTOR® Association data shows interest rates continuing to trend down


State of the Market

  • October’s interest rate was recorded at 6.0%, down from 6.1% in September. This is the lowest interest rates have been since September 2024.
  • New listings rose 9.0% from September to October, with 3,676 new homes on the market in October, compared to 3,371 in September.
  • Overall sales increased by 4.0% from September to October. There were 2,245 sales in September and 2,335 sales in October.
  • Inventory for October was recorded at 13,047, up 0.3% from September when inventory was recorded at 13,007.
